WebFeb 16, 2024 · No Korean New Year celebration is complete without tteokguk, or rice cake soup. Eating a bowl of it is said to bring a person a long life. Eating tteokhuk also represents growing another year older. In fact, Koreans may ask a person their age by saying “how many bowls of tteokguk have you eaten?”. Tteok (떡) is the Korean word for rice cake, and refers to both the glutinous and non-glutinous forms. Garaetteok is made with non-glutinous rice flour ( maepssal-garu ), while baram-tteok (for example) is made with glutinous rice flour ( chapssal-garu ). mcgee and co bathroom mirror
